Special features of microfibers in cleanroom

Due to its special properties in absorbing both lipophilic and hydrophilic contaminants, microfiber is particularly well suited for cleanroom cleaning. Since it leaves hardly any particles behind during the cleaning process, it is ideal for both particle-sensitive and germ-sensitive cleanrooms. It can also be used in a variety of ways, both in the form of cloths and as a mop.
